The Friends of Distinction carved out a significant place in the musical landscape by embodying a seamless blend of pop sensibility and psychedelic soul. Their ability to weave catchy melodies with rich, layered harmonies provided a fresh perspective during a time when music was becoming increasingly experimental. This group not only resonated with audiences seeking feel-good vibes but also influenced subsequent generations of artists who sought to infuse soulful elements into mainstream pop. Approaching their craft with an emphasis on vocal harmony and groove, The Friends of Distinction developed a sound that is both inviting and complex. Their innovative arrangements showcase a sophisticated interplay between instruments and voices, allowing for a sonic experience that feels both familiar and refreshing. This focus on melody combined with rhythmic intricacies elevates their music beyond standard pop fare, creating moments that invite listeners to engage deeply. Lyrically, The Friends of Distinction often explore themes of love, community, and introspection, balancing sincerity with a playful charm. Their songwriting approach tends toward storytelling, using vivid imagery and relatable experiences to connect emotionally with their audience. This mixture of genuine expression and lightheartedness creates a unique listening experience that resonates across generations.
